Hello, thank you for the plugin!
I tried to compile on Mac High Sierra.
First, an error with make, which was resolved by deleting the /build directory.
Then the following error
c/DTROY.cpp:182:65: error: no member named 'round' in namespace 'std'; did you
mean 'roundl'?
...+ i].value = static_cast<int>(std::round(randomf()*7))
which was resolved by adding
#include "cmath" to the top of Bidoo.hpp

this is just an idea i had while fooling around with chute and i wanted to share it.
it's basically a rolling ball in a square area that triggers gates whenever
it collides with one of the borders. voltage according to the position it hits the wall.
ball receives pushes from a gate/trig with angle and acceleration set by cv inputs.
adjustable friction, amount of rebound, surface-area to ball-size ratio.
here's a visual mock-up:
unfortunately can't code this myself, but maybe i get lucky and you like the idea.

watching some demo videos for the metropolis hardware, i came across a kind of similar module.
the detroit underground du-seq, has two additional gate modes for each step to choose from one
of two external gate inputs. this can be used to replace the internal gate signals that fire at each pulse
with the ones from the inputs.
here's the example: https://youtu.be/dtj4IQCt1JU?t=13m8s
i think this would be a nice addition to your already awesome seq.
